Team — the Parcelgram webhook for delivery-status events goes live Thursday. Payload schema is unchanged from the draft we shared; retries follow exponential backoff, max five attempts. Please confirm your endpoint returns 2xx within three seconds. For validation calls against our sandbox, authenticate with the token directly below.

session JWT of yawep-yawep = eyJhbGciOiJIUzI1NiIsInR5cCI6IkpXVCJ9.eyJzdWIiOiI3pWF3_In0.aXYsHiog

**Mgmt Meeting Minutes — Retiring the Brightline Range**

Quick recap for sales leads at Fenholt Supplies: we agreed to retire the Brightline fixture range by year-end. Remaining stock moves to clearance pricing next month, and accounts on standing orders get migrated to the Lumetta range. Trade-in incentives were approved in principle. The confidential note on next steps sits just below.

board note of bajof-bajeg: The pricing group signed off on a budget of $13.4 million for Project Sildor. The renewal with Lamixek Holdings closes at $48.9 million a year, 49 percent above the last contract.

### Log Compaction Endpoint

Quick note for review: the `/compact` endpoint on Pipewren queues a compaction pass that drops superseded messages per key, keeping only the latest offset. It's async, so poll the job status afterward. Compaction calls against the staging broker need internal auth, so include the key shown below in your headers.

service key, tadup-tahog: zpat7_wB1tnEL